True experiential learning involves a cycle of concrete experience, reflective observation, abstract conceptalization, and active experimentation.
Transformational learning involves a lengthy and complicated 10-step process.
It is important to move past the instructor-centered approach to teaching and put the cognitive load on the students for more meaningful learning.
